高级系统管理工程师如何提升企业IT基础设施的稳定性与安全性
在数字化转型加速推进的今天,企业对IT基础设施的依赖程度越来越高。作为连接业务需求与技术实现的核心角色,高级系统管理工程师(Senior System Administrator)不仅需要掌握扎实的技术功底,还必须具备前瞻性思维、风险管控能力和跨部门协作意识。他们不仅是系统的“守护者”,更是组织数字化战略落地的关键推动者。
一、理解岗位职责:从运维到战略支撑
传统意义上的系统管理员主要负责服务器部署、用户权限管理、日常监控和故障处理等基础工作。而高级系统管理工程师则需站在更高的维度思考问题:
- 架构设计能力:能够根据业务增长趋势规划高可用、可扩展的系统架构;
- 安全合规意识:熟悉GDPR、等保2.0、ISO 27001等行业标准,确保系统符合法律与行业规范;
- 自动化与DevOps实践:通过脚本、CI/CD流水线、容器化技术减少人工干预,提高效率;
- 性能调优与容量规划:基于历史数据预测资源瓶颈,提前扩容或优化配置;
- 应急响应与灾备机制:建立完善的备份策略、灾难恢复计划(DRP)和演练流程。
这些能力决定了高级系统管理工程师是否能将日常运维转化为价值创造,从而成为企业IT治理的重要参与者。
二、关键技术栈:构建坚实的技术底座
要胜任高级系统管理工程师的角色,必须精通以下几类核心技术:
1. 操作系统深度管理
无论是Linux(CentOS、Ubuntu Server)、Windows Server还是Unix变种,高级工程师都应掌握内核参数调优、进程调度机制、文件系统优化(如ext4、XFS)、SELinux/AppArmor安全策略等。例如,在面对数据库频繁I/O等待时,可以通过调整vm.dirty_ratio和io.schedu ler参数来缓解磁盘压力。
2. 虚拟化与云原生技术
随着私有云、混合云和公有云(AWS、Azure、阿里云)的普及,高级系统管理工程师必须熟练使用VMware vSphere、KVM、Hyper-V以及Docker、Kubernetes等容器编排工具。这不仅能提升资源利用率,还能增强应用的弹性伸缩能力。
3. 自动化运维工具链
Ansible、Puppet、Chef、SaltStack等配置管理工具已成为标配。结合GitOps理念,可以实现基础设施即代码(IaC),让每一次变更都有迹可循、可回滚、可审计。例如,使用Terraform定义AWS EC2实例模板,配合GitHub Actions自动部署,极大降低人为错误率。
4. 监控与日志分析体系
Prometheus + Grafana用于指标可视化,ELK Stack(Elasticsearch, Logstash, Kibana)或Loki+Grafana用于日志集中管理。高级工程师应能设置合理的告警阈值,避免“告警疲劳”,并通过根因分析定位问题本质。
三、实战案例:如何解决一次重大生产事故
某电商平台在双十一前夕遭遇突发性服务中断,访问延迟飙升至5秒以上,订单提交失败率达60%。经排查,发现是Redis缓存集群因内存不足导致频繁淘汰热点数据,进而引发数据库雪崩效应。
该事件由高级系统管理工程师主导处置,具体步骤如下:
- 快速定位问题:通过Zabbix实时监控发现Redis内存占用率突破95%,且大量Key被LRU淘汰;
- 临时缓解措施:手动扩大Redis实例内存并重启哨兵模式以恢复读写分离;
- 根本原因分析:审查应用层代码发现存在未设置过期时间的Session缓存,导致内存持续膨胀;
- 长期改进方案:引入Redisson客户端自动清理无用缓存,并建立每日缓存健康检查脚本;
- 复盘与培训:组织团队学习缓存设计最佳实践,编写《缓存使用规范手册》下发至开发组。
这一案例表明,高级系统管理工程师不仅要懂技术,更要具备“从现象到本质”的问题拆解能力,以及推动组织流程优化的执行力。
四、软技能:沟通力、领导力与前瞻视野
技术之外,高级系统管理工程师还需培养三大软技能:
1. 跨部门协作能力
与开发团队紧密合作,推动CI/CD流程标准化;与安全团队共建漏洞扫描机制;与业务部门沟通资源需求,平衡成本与性能。良好的沟通技巧有助于减少误解,提升协同效率。
2. 技术影响力与知识沉淀
撰写技术文档、录制视频教程、定期分享技术心得,可以帮助团队成员快速成长。例如,建立内部Wiki平台记录常见故障处理指南,既能节省重复劳动,又能提升整体技术水平。
3. 战略思维与趋势洞察
关注AI驱动的智能运维(AIOps)、零信任架构(Zero Trust)、边缘计算等新兴方向,主动提出技术升级建议。比如,在公司新项目中引入Service Mesh(如Istio)提升微服务间通信的安全性和可观测性。
五、职业发展路径:从执行者到架构师
高级系统管理工程师并非终点,而是通往更广阔舞台的跳板。典型晋升路径包括:
- 初级系统管理员 → 中级系统工程师 → 高级系统管理工程师:完成技术积累与项目经验沉淀;
- 高级系统管理工程师 → DevOps工程师 / SRE(站点可靠性工程师):向自动化、智能化运维演进;
- 高级系统管理工程师 → IT架构师 / 系统总监:参与企业级IT战略制定,主导大型项目的系统选型与实施。
在这个过程中,持续学习和认证加持至关重要。推荐考取如红帽RHCA、AWS Certified SysOps Administrator、Google Cloud Professional Operations Engineer等权威证书,增强专业可信度。
六、结语:成为企业数字化转型的“幕后英雄”
高级系统管理工程师的工作往往不被外界看见,但却是保障企业稳定运行的基石。他们用代码守护数据,用策略防范风险,用智慧赋能业务。未来,随着AI、大数据、物联网的发展,这一角色将更加重要。每一位有志于此的专业人士,都应该不断提升自我,从“会操作”走向“懂架构”,从“解决问题”迈向“预防问题”,最终成为企业数字化转型道路上不可或缺的力量。

